We follow the same rules set forth by s2ki.com.

If you are not a registered owner, you cannot sell, period. No exceptions, no ifs, no buts, no anything. So if you're not an owner, and post a FS thread, then you can EXPECT to have your thread closed and removed.

See this thread for more info... http://forums.s2ki.com/forums/showthread.p...threadid=184409

Please be aware we are doing this to protect real owners and paying members from being defrauded. Note also that we let many things slide in here, but we have zero tolerance with regards to this. Thank you.

Tommy, assuming all FS threads in the South FL forums will lead to a face to face transaction, is it not redundant to follow the S2KI rules in this regard? If i'm not mistaken, the general site rules are to protect fraudulent activity when there is no personal contact throught the process.

I can't assume all local transactions will result in face to face contact. South FL covers many miles from Homestead to Boca Raton. Also other members, especially from the FL Club frequent this community forum.

This rule is directed at those who are not club members or regular participants of the club and/or non-S2000 owners.

I was prompted to post this yesterday after receiving a few PM's asking for clarification regarding this issue.
